- Around 19 trains per day.
- Around 6 buses per day.
However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Florence and Pordenone as scheduled services by train and bus can vary by season or day of the week.
- Trains mostly depart from Florence Santa Maria Novella and arrive in Pordenone station.
- Buses mostly depart from Scandicci, Villa Costanza (Florence) and arrive in Pordenone, Autostazione.
- Travel with Frecciarossa, Italo, Regionale, Intercity, Intercity Notte to go to Pordenone by train.
- Travel with Marino Autolinee to go to Pordenone by bus.
- 3 direct trains per day with Frecciarossa, Intercity.
